    Bubs lodges letter of intent with FDA to become a permanent seller in the USA

    After a successful entry into the USA during their recent dairy crisis, infant nutrition and dairy specialist Bubs Australia (ASX: BUB) has lodged a letter of intent to continue selling six Bubs Infant Formula products in the country till October 2025 and beyond. The Australian Company is one of only eight infant formula manufacturers globally

    Toys”R”Us struggles to win big from Australia re-launch, suffers losses of up to $25 million in FY22

    Seems like few Aussies are into buying toys online as online toy retailer Toys“R”Us (ASX: TOY) reports total losses of up to $25 million despite increasing its marketing budget by over threefold! The Company is the exclusive licensee for Toys“R”Us, Babies“R”Us and associated intellectual property in Australia and New Zealand, where it relaunched in 2020
